Spork! Poetry Halloween Special

Join Spork! this Halloween for another spectacular & spooky spoken-word event, featuring the annual “Dead Poets Slam,” and the gruesome twosome of silly poetry; Chris “Ghostly” White, and Edward “Dead Wood” Tripp.

Chris White is a poet, performer and the founder of Spork! A multiple slam winner, his poems about love, ducks and other wet things are soul-searching, subversive and silly.

Edward Tripp is an award winning, provocative, and prop-heavy performer; a stand-up poet, with a penchant for the ridiculous. “A roaring fi re of absurd wit,” – Cor Blimey

THE SLAM – GET INVOLVED!

Six famous poets will rise from the dead, brought to life by six contemporary artists for one night only! They’ll battle it out in a chance to win everlasting life, plus a cash prize of £100.

Using a mixture of their own poetry, the work of their alias, and some stuff they make up on the night. Expect punches, pithy remarks and pure fi re, in the ultimate graveyard smash.
